Tender Overview

The opportunity is issued by the Marketing Division, Indian Oil Corporation Limited for carrying out third party services for quality assurance at external statutory testing and repainting unit at BadDI BP, Solan, Himachal Pradesh. The estimated value is ₹23,66,076 for three years including GST, with a delivery period spanning three years. Bidders must engage via the GeM portal for an indigenous, compliant bid, and must submit a Bid Security Declaration in lieu of EMD. The contract allows a 25% quantity or duration adjustment at contract issue and thereafter, with bidders bound to accept revised scope. The procurement emphasizes QA testing and repainting work under statutory requirements and is time-bound to the GeM submission window. This is a targeted, in-scope service tender designed for suppliers with support capabilities in quality assurance for external testing and repainting units.
